Suit up, folks: "How I Met Your Mother" is turning 150 legendary episodes young very soon, and the occasion is marked with a New York City departure and the return of Kal Penn to continue kinda-sorta pitching some woo.

The hit CBS sitcom that's rivaled only by "Community" in making superb continuity and call-backs an art form provided Entertainment Weekly with these stills from the landmark episode's shoot and it looks like Penn's therapist character Kevin will continue edging into romantic sparks flying between himself and Robin (Cobie Smulders).

He's apparently even making himself at home amid the lions' den that is drinking with the gang at McLaren's.

But elsewhere, it's somewhat the end of an era, apparently. EW reports that the episode will mark model-couple Lily (Alyson Hannigan) and Marshall (Jason Segel) finally leaving for a quiet life in the suburbs - once they pair can negotiate moving Lily's dug-in dad out of their current digs.

Hm. Between that sticking point and Barney's (Neil Patrick Harris) perpetual resistance to any member of the gang straying too far off the reservation, I'd have to guess that Marshmallow and his Lily-pad won't be allowed to go quietly into that more sedate life.
